Background
Chattanooga Neighborhood Enterprise was founded in 1986 as a nonprofit to help families navigate the homebuying process and become successful, lifelong homeowners. For over 30 years, we’ve used our ingenuity and innovative spirit to help over 13,000 clients, including families, individuals and small businesses, to secure loans, purchase homes and keep the homes they love. Additionally, through our revitalization and development work, we’ve been able to provide over 5,000 stable homes in diverse, urban neighborhoods with potential to thrive.
